Overview of the role
We have an exciting opportunity for a Talent Acquisition Business Partner to join our talent acquisition team in Cork or Dublin on a 12-month contract.
In this role, you will support across all of our business units and will take the lead in proactively identifying, engaging, and attracting top talent to support the business during a high-growth period.
If you're passionate about proactive sourcing and thrive in a fast-paced environment, we'd love to hear from you.
Key responsibilities and duties include:
Proactively source and engage candidates through LinkedIn, job boards, talent communities, and innovative sourcing channels
Conduct talent mapping and market research to identify emerging talent pools and inform hiring decisions
Partner with hiring managers to lead recruitment kick-off meetings, define role requirements, and align on sourcing strategies
Implement advanced sourcing strategies to connect with top talent
Build and maintain a strong pipeline of qualified candidates for current and future hiring needs, ensuring a continuous flow of talent
Manage the end-to-end candidate experience, from initial contact through to offer acceptance, ensuring the candidate experience aligns with company standards
Deliver strategic insights on talent availability, competitor activity, and market trends to influence recruitment planning
Demonstrated ability to identify talent within the engineering sector across Ireland
Experience influencing business stakeholders to deliver positive outcomes
Proven experience in a talent acquisition or external recruitment role with significant proactive sourcing responsibility and stakeholder interaction
Proficiency in using various sourcing channels, tools like LinkedIn for recruitment insights, and applicant tracking systems
